- Certified Nurse Midwife
Description
Job Summary
The Certified Nurse Midwife provides comprehensive midwifery care and treatment to pregnant, postpartum, gynecology, and family planning patients within women’s services practices. The role includes developing and maintaining collaborative and consultative relationships with physicians and other healthcare providers to ensure high-quality, patient-centered care.
Key Responsibilities
Provide prenatal, intrapartum, postpartum, gynecologic, and family planning care
Perform assessments, examinations, and develop individualized care plans
Prescribe medications and treatments in accordance with state regulations
Maintain collaborative agreements with supervising physicians as required
Educate patients and families on health promotion, pregnancy, childbirth, and reproductive health
Document patient care accurately in electronic medical records
Work collaboratively with interdisciplinary healthcare teams
Demonstrate appropriate clinical independence while ensuring safe, evidence-based practice
Requirements
Qualifications
Education:
Graduate of an Accreditation Commission for Midwifery Education (ACME) accredited midwifery education program
Experience:
None required
Licensure/Certifications/Registration:
Current Licensed Nurse Practitioner (LNP)
Registered Nurse (RN) licensure
DEA license
Collaborative agreement with a physician as required by state regulations
Life Support:
AHA BLS-HCP certification required
Other Minimum Qualifications:
Eligible for prescriptive authority in accordance with state regulations
Strong written and verbal communication skills
Computer literacy, including electronic medical records systems
Ability to work collaboratively with physicians and healthcare providers
Demonstrates appropriate independence in clinical practice
